
CAS 2605-14-3: 2-Chloro-6-methoxybenzothiazole
Formula:C8H6ClNOS
InChI:InChI=1S/C8H6ClNOS/c1-11-5-2-3-6-7(4-5)12-8(9)10-6/h2-4H,1H3
InChI key:InChIKey=FVUFTABOJFRHSU-UHFFFAOYSA-N
SMILES:ClC1=NC=2C(=CC(OC)=CC2)S1
Synonyms:- 2-Chloro-6-(methyloxy)-1,3-benzothiazole
- 2-Chloro-6-Methoxy-1,3-Benzothiazole
- 2-Chloro-6-methoxy-1,3-benzothiazol
- 2-Chloro-6-methoxybenzo[d]thiazole
- 2-Chloro-6-methoxybenzothiazole
- 6-Methoxy-2-chlorobenzothiazole
- Benzothiazole, 2-chloro-6-methoxy-
- NSC 118120
